### About HeroFi

HeroFi stands as the ultimate hub of Defi innovation, empowering individual users to amplify assets through pioneering restaking strategies and savvy management integrations. For projects, HeroFi serves as a versatile platform, facilitating optimized asset growth and driving sustainable development within the dynamic digital asset ecosystem.
